How to Seated Row Machine
Seated Row Machine muscles worked: Back
Form
- 1. Ziehen Sie beim Zusammenziehen Ihrer Schulterblätter natürlich Ihre Arme.
- 2. Ziehen Sie, bis Ihre Ellbogen vertikal sind.
- 3. Kehren Sie in die Ausgangsposition zurück, indem Sie Ihre Ellbogen vollständig strecken und Ihren Rücken gerade halten.
Coach's Comment
- 1. Bitte sei vorsichtig, dass deine Ellbogen nicht nach außen zeigen.
- 2. Bitte halte deine Brust offen, um ein Beugen deiner Taille zu vermeiden.

How to T-Bar Row Machine
T-Bar Row Machine muscles worked: Back
Form
- 1. Ziehe deine Schulterblätter zusammen und ziehe deine Arme natürlich nach hinten.
- 2. Ziehe deine Ellbogen zurück, bis sie hinter deinem Körper sind.
- 3. Halte deine Brust offen und strecke langsam deine Arme aus.
Coach's Comment
- Bitte halte deine Brust oben, um ein Beugen deiner Taille zu vermeiden.
